Rovers eye Gudjohnsen loan swoop

January 26, 2010 11:01 · 0 comments

Blackburn are understood to be seeking a loan swoop for former Chelsea forward Eidur Gudjohnsen, with Benni McCarthy closing in on a move to West Ham.

McCarthy has angered Rovers boss Sam Allardyce by failing to turn up for training on the last two days and it looks as though the player is heading to West Ham.

The South African has made it clear he wants to move on and a switch to Upton Park is expected to go through, even though Allardyce says there is still work to be done.

The Blackburn boss revealed: “We have said all along that we will listen to offers, but only agree to sell if both the commercial and football reasons satisfy Blackburn Rovers. That situation remains unchanged.”

Allardyce is now eyeing a loan deal for Icelandic star Gudjohnsen, who only joined Monaco in the summer from Barcelona.

The Blackburn manager worked with the 31-year-old during his time in charge at Bolton and that could be a key factor in potential January deal.
